How much does a queen bee cost? In 2026, a practical U.S. retail range for a standard mated queen is about $35 to $65 before shipping. Current breeder listings span that range, with price affected by genetics, marking, breeder reputation, season, availability and whether the queen is shipped or collected locally.
Virgin queens can cost less because they have not yet completed mating flights or proved themselves as laying queens. Special breeder queens, instrumentally inseminated queens or tightly selected genetic lines can cost considerably more. So the useful answer is not “a queen costs X dollars”; it is “what type of queen are you buying, and what problem are you trying to solve?”
TL;DR: Expect roughly $35–65 for many standard mated queens in the U.S. in 2026, with virgin queens often cheaper and specialist breeder queens potentially much more expensive. What Does a Queen Bee Cost in 2026?
Current 2026 listings from U.S. queen producers show standard mated queens at around $35, $39, $40, $45 and $60 depending on breeder and stock. Other locally raised mated queens are listed around $65. That gives us a much more useful current range than the old $19–42 figures that appeared in this article.
Price alone does not tell you queen quality. You may pay extra for a marked queen, selected stock, particular genetic background, breeder reputation, instrumental insemination or simply because supply is tight at that point in the season.
Availability is also seasonal. Good breeders can sell out, and live-queen shipping depends on weather, location and biosecurity rules. If timing matters, order before the colony reaches the point where you are desperately trying to find any queen that can arrive tomorrow.

Virgin Queen vs Mated Queen Cost
A virgin queen is usually cheaper because she still has to complete mating flights successfully. In 2026, some sellers are listing virgin queens around $20–25 while their mated queens cost much more. The lower purchase price comes with extra biological risk: weather can disrupt mating, drones may be scarce and the queen may fail to return or fail to develop into a useful layer.
A mated queen costs more because the producer has carried much of that risk already. She has completed mating and should have begun laying before sale. For most beginners replacing a failed queen, that extra certainty is often worth paying for.
What Are You Actually Paying For?
When you buy a queen, you are buying reproductive potential from a catalogue. That sounds clinical, but that is essentially what is happening. You are paying for a queen produced from selected stock, mated under particular conditions and handled well enough to arrive alive and ready to establish herself in another colony.
The queen herself contributes half of the nuclear DNA to each worker. The other half comes from one of the multiple drones she mated with. Because honey bee queens are highly polyandrous, a colony contains workers belonging to multiple paternal lines. That within-colony genetic diversity is one reason honey bee genetics are more interesting than simply saying “this is an Italian hive” or “this is a Carniolan hive.”

How to Buy a Queen Bee
Buy from a breeder who can tell you what you are getting. Useful questions include whether the queen is virgin or mated, whether she is marked, what stock or selection program she comes from, when she was produced, how she is shipped and what live-arrival or replacement policy applies.
I would also pay attention to the breeder’s objectives. Some operations select heavily for production, temperament, overwintering, Varroa-sensitive hygiene or other traits. Others are supplying broadly useful commercial stock. The label matters less than whether the breeder has a sensible selection program and can explain it.

What About Queen Banking?
Queen breeders sometimes store multiple caged queens in a queenless colony or specialised bank so workers can feed and maintain them until sale or use. Queen banking is a real and useful production technique, but the old explanation that the queens’ pheromones simply “fight with each other” is too crude.
Research shows that banking conditions can affect queen survival and physiology, particularly when queens are stored for long periods or under poor conditions. Recent studies have found differences in queen weight, ovary condition, stress responses and survival depending on how queens are banked, while other work shows well-managed banked queens can later perform comparably to newly mated queens.
For the buyer, the sensible question is not whether a queen has ever been banked. It is whether the producer handles, stores and ships queens well.
How to Replace a Queen Safely
First, make sure the colony really needs a queen. If you need help locating her, use the guide on how to find the queen bee in a hive. If the colony is being divided, splitting the hive changes the introduction plan as well.
If you are replacing an existing queen, remove the old queen and give the colony some queenless time before installing the new queen in her cage. Current extension guidance for slow-release introductions commonly allows roughly 30 minutes to 24 hours of queenlessness before the cage is installed.
Place the cage where young workers can contact and feed the queen, usually around the brood area, and follow the supplier’s candy-release instructions. Do not assume acceptance is guaranteed. A colony that still has its old queen, an unnoticed virgin queen or viable queen cells may reject the queen you just paid good money for.

Commercial Queens vs Backyard Breeding
Commercial beekeeping needs consistency. Large operators generally cannot manage thousands of colonies as separate genetic art projects. They need bees that are reasonably predictable in temperament, productivity, seasonal build-up and management response.
Backyard beekeeping gives us more freedom to experiment. I still like the idea that small-scale beekeepers can maintain useful genetic variation and identify colonies that perform particularly well under local conditions. That is worth doing.
Where I would tighten my old advice is the suggestion that simply buying Italian, Carniolan and Russian queens and letting everything mix automatically creates superior locally adapted bees. It creates admixture and variation, certainly. Local adaptation only emerges if the environment and beekeeper then select useful traits over generations.
Genetic diversity gives selection something to work with. It is not a substitute for selection.
Can Backyard Beekeepers Contribute Useful Genetics?
Absolutely. If you have a colony that repeatedly performs unusually well, keep records. Look at survival, temperament, honey production, swarming, brood pattern and whatever pest-resistance traits you can actually measure. One good year does not make a breeding line, but repeated performance gets interesting.
If you eventually have genuinely unusual locally adapted stock, talking to an experienced queen breeder or breeding group can be worthwhile. The useful contribution is not “my bees seem awesome”; it is a colony with a documented performance history and traits worth evaluating.
Genetics are a gift — we inherit them from previous generations and we build on them. Diversity gives us possibilities, while excessive inbreeding can reduce fitness. But diversity by itself is not a magic shield against disease, poor management or unsuitable local conditions.
So Is an Expensive Queen Worth It?
Sometimes. If you need a colony queenright quickly, a reliable mated queen can save weeks of uncertainty. If you are deliberately breeding for a particular trait, a more expensive selected queen may be a sensible investment. If you are buying a fancy genetic label without any plan to evaluate the result, the extra money may achieve very little.
That is why I still come back to the same conclusion: a good queen is worth far more than the cage she arrives in. If she produces a healthy, manageable and productive colony, the difference between paying $40 and $60 becomes fairly trivial.

Frequently Asked Questions
How much does a queen bee cost in 2026?
For a standard mated queen in the United States, a practical 2026 retail range is about $35 to $65 before shipping. Current breeder examples include queens around $35, $39, $40, $45, $60 and $65, depending on supplier, stock, marking and pickup or shipping arrangements.
Are virgin queen bees cheaper than mated queens?
Usually, yes. A virgin queen has not yet completed mating flights or proven that she can establish a good laying pattern, so the buyer takes on more risk. Some 2026 sellers list virgin queens around $20 to $25 while mated queens from the same or similar markets cost considerably more.
Is an expensive queen automatically better?
No. Price can reflect genetics, breeder selection, marking, instrumental insemination, shipping, scarcity or reputation, but the queen still has to perform in your colony and your local conditions. Brood pattern, temperament, survival and colony performance matter more than price alone.
How long should a hive be queenless before introducing a new queen?
Common slow-release practice is to let the colony remain queenless for roughly 30 minutes to 24 hours before installing the caged replacement queen. Acceptance is never guaranteed, so follow the breeder’s introduction instructions and confirm the old queen and competing queen cells are not undermining the introduction.
Should beginner beekeepers buy queens or raise their own?
Buying a good mated queen is often the simplest option when you need predictable timing. Raising your own queens becomes more useful once you can confidently assess colony health, queen quality, brood, queen cells, drones and local mating conditions.
Why does honey bee genetic diversity matter?
Honey bee queens mate with multiple drones, creating several paternal lines of workers within one colony. Genetic diversity can influence colony-level traits, but simply mixing named bee strains does not guarantee better local adaptation or disease resistance. Useful breeding requires selection over time.
